Enhanced Trust and Credibility

**Business Benefits of Transparent On-Chain Financial Reporting: Enhanced Trust and Credibility** In today's digital age, transparency has become paramount for businesses seeking to establish trust and credibility with stakeholders. On-chain financial reporting, leveraging blockchain technology, offers a transformative solution for enhancing transparency and fostering stakeholder confidence. Blockchain's immutable and decentralized nature ensures that financial data is securely recorded and accessible to all authorized parties. This eliminates the risk of data manipulation or fraud, providing a reliable and verifiable source of information. By making financial records publicly available, businesses demonstrate their commitment to transparency and accountability. Transparency fosters trust among customers, investors, and partners. When stakeholders can access accurate and up-to-date financial information, they gain confidence in the business's financial health and decision-making processes. This trust translates into increased customer loyalty, investor interest, and stronger partnerships. Moreover, on-chain financial reporting enhances credibility by providing an independent and verifiable record of transactions. Auditors and regulators can easily access and analyze financial data, reducing the need for costly and time-consuming audits. This streamlined process saves businesses time and resources while 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ements. Transparency also promotes ethical behavior within the organization. Employees are more likely to adhere to ethical standards when they know that their actions are being recorded and scrutinized. This fosters a culture of integrity and accountability, reducing the risk of financial misconduct. Furthermore, on-chain financial reporting can improve operational efficiency. By automating financial processes and eliminating the need for manual data entry, businesses can streamline their operations and reduce costs. The real-time availability of financial data also enables faster decision-making and better resource allocation. In conclusion, transparent on-chain financial reporting offers significant benefits for businesses seeking to enhance trust and credibility. By providing stakeholders with secure and verifiable financial information, businesses can foster trust, attract investors, strengthen partnerships, promote ethical behavior, and improve operational efficiency. As blockchain technology continues to evolve, on-chain financial reporting is poised to become an essential tool for businesses committed to transparency and accountability.

Improved Risk Management and Compliance

Business Benefits of Transparent On-Chain Financial Reporting
**Business Benefits of Transparent On-Chain Financial Reporting: Improved Risk Management and Compliance** In today's digital age, businesses are increasingly leveraging blockchain technology to enhance their financial reporting processes. On-chain financial reporting, which involves recording financial transactions on a public blockchain, offers numerous benefits, including improved risk management and compliance. **Enhanced Risk Management** On-chain financial reporting provides a tamper-proof and immutable record of all transactions. This eliminates the risk of data manipulation or fraud, as any changes to the ledger are immediately visible to all participants. By leveraging this transparency, businesses can proactively identify and mitigate potential risks. For instance, a company can use on-chain financial reporting to track the movement of funds in real-time. This allows them to detect suspicious transactions or unauthorized withdrawals, enabling them to take swift action to prevent financial losses. **Improved Compliance** Regulatory compliance is a critical aspect of financial reporting. On-chain financial reporting simplifies compliance by providing a verifiable and auditable record of all transactions. This eliminates the need for manual reconciliation and reduces the risk of errors or omissions. Moreover, blockchain technology can automate compliance processes. Smart contracts can be programmed to enforce specific rules and regulations, ensuring that transactions adhere to established standards. This reduces the burden on compliance teams and enhances the accuracy and efficiency of reporting. **Increased Trust and Transparency** On-chain financial reporting fosters trust and transparency among stakeholders. By making financial data publicly available, businesses demonstrate their commitment to accountability and ethical practices. This can enhance investor confidence, attract new customers, and strengthen relationships with partners. For example, a company that publishes its financial statements on a blockchain can provide investors with real-time access to accurate and reliable information. This transparency builds trust and encourages investment. **Reduced Costs and Time** On-chain financial reporting can significantly reduce the costs and time associated with traditional reporting methods. By eliminating the need for manual data entry and reconciliation, businesses can streamline their processes and free up resources for other value-added activities. Additionally, the immutability of blockchain records reduces the risk of disputes and the need for costly audits. This can further reduce expenses and improve operational efficiency. **Conclusion** Transparent on-chain financial reporting offers numerous benefits for businesses, including improved risk management, enhanced compliance, increased trust and transparency, and reduced costs and time. By leveraging blockchain technology, businesses can gain a competitive advantage, strengthen their financial position, and build a more sustainable and ethical operating environment.

Increased Efficiency and Cost Savings

**Business Benefits of Transparent On-Chain Financial Reporting: Increased Efficiency and Cost Savings** In today's digital age, businesses are increasingly turning to blockchain technology to enhance their financial reporting processes. On-chain financial reporting, which involves recording financial transactions on a public blockchain, offers numerous benefits, including increased efficiency and cost savings. One of the key advantages of on-chain financial reporting is its ability to streamline accounting processes. By automating the recording and verification of transactions, businesses can eliminate manual errors and reduce the time spent on data entry. This automation also eliminates the need for third-party auditors, further reducing costs. Moreover, on-chain financial reporting provides real-time visibility into financial data. This allows businesses to monitor their cash flow, expenses, and revenue in real-time, enabling them to make informed decisions quickly. The transparency of blockchain technology also eliminates the risk of fraud and manipulation, as all transactions are recorded immutably on the public ledger. Furthermore, on-chain financial reporting can improve relationships with stakeholders. By providing transparent and auditable financial data, businesses can build trust with investors, creditors, and customers. This transparency can also enhance the company's reputation and attract new business opportunities. In addition to the efficiency and cost savings benefits, on-chain financial reporting can also improve compliance with regulatory requirements. By recording financial transactions on a public blockchain, businesses can create an immutable audit trail that meets the requirements of various regulatory bodies. This can reduce the risk of fines and penalties for non-compliance. However, it is important to note that on-chain financial reporting is not without its challenges. Businesses need to consider the privacy implications of recording financial data on a public blockchain. Additionally, the technology is still relatively new, and there may be a learning curve for businesses to implement and manage on-chain financial reporting systems. Despite these challenges, the benefits of transparent on-chain financial reporting far outweigh the risks. By embracing this technology, businesses can streamline their accounting processes, reduce costs, improve compliance, and build trust with stakeholders. As blockchain technology continues to evolve, on-chain financial reporting is poised to become an essential tool for businesses seeking to enhance their financial operations.
